Products
96SEO 2025-09-14 11:37 1
Dedecms作为国内广泛使用的内容管理系统,其后台操作的稳定性和用户体验一直是网站管理员关注的重点。只是 最近不少用户反映dede后台菜单出现错位问题,特别是在文档列表界面下掉、布局混乱的现象频发,这给日常管理带来了极大困扰。
本文将基于最新版本的Dedecms后台, 菜单错位和文档列表下掉问题的成因,并提供具体可行的解决方案。无论你是新手还是资深站长,都能通过本文找到快速修复问题的方法。
1. 什么是菜单错位?
在Dedecms后台管理界面中, 菜单结构应当整齐排列,方便管理员快速定位功能模块。只是 有时由于样式文件冲突、浏览器兼容性或代码更新导致CSS失效,会出现左侧菜单栏层叠混乱,按钮错开或重叠,使得操作异常不便。
2. 文档列表“下掉”具体表现
这种情况不仅影响页面美观,更严重影响内容编辑效率和数据准确性。
dede官方模板升级或者第三方插件安装可能覆盖默认CSS文件,其中浮动属性、内边距等设置如果被错误修改或丢失,会导致页面元素定位异常。比方说某些关键class如.flrct
含有float:left;
属性未按预期生效。
dede模板文件夹中的/templets/
目录存放着后台UI模板。误删或修改index_*.htm等核心文件会破坏原有布局结构,引发元素“跑位”。此类错误通常伴随代码标签缺失或闭合错误。
dede后台多采用传统HTML+CSS实现,不同浏览器渲染差异可能导致浮动及定位异常。特别是在新版Chrome、Firefox等更新后一些老旧CSS写法不再兼容,需适配更新。
dede系统缓存机制如果未正确刷新,新旧样式文件一边存在时会造成页面加载混乱。清理网站缓存和浏览器缓存往往能缓解部分显示异常症状。
- 找到关键CSS定义:
/admin/images/css/
, /admin/templets/style.css
, 或者直接内嵌于htm模版中。.flrct { padding-top: 3px; float:left; }
- 修复办法:
// 以.flrct为例, 将float:left删除
.flrct {
padding-top: 3px;
/* float: left; */ /* 注释或删除此行 */
}
删除float属性后元素将取消左浮动状态,有助于恢复整体布局稳定性。调整后上传替换服务器对应文件即可生效!这是解决菜单错位最简单有效的方法之一!
- 找到模板路径:
/admin/templets/index_main.htm
/admin/templets/index_nav.htm
/admin/templets/index_list.htm
- 检查HTML结构是否完整:
Demand feedback